Obviously you've never played "Six Degrees of Kevin Bacon" where almost anybody on earth can be associated with Kevin Bacon by six folks, here let me show how it's done using me:

 

1. I was on "Jeopardy" (no joke!) in December, 2000, where I met...

2. Alex Trebek who is the host of "Jeopardy!" and was the host when....

3. Tim Daly appeared on "Celebrity Jeopardy!", and he was in "Diner" with...

4. Kevin Bacon.

 

or

 

1. I had a girlfriend named Mary who ....

2. Had a friend named Laura who had dinner to discuss a movie role with ...

3. Robert DeNiro one night in Boca Raton, who was in "Sleepers" with...

4. Kevin Bacon.

 

So there, I'm separated from Kevin Bacon twice over by three people. :D

That's why Kevin Bacon is a pop culture icon. Try "playing" that game. Someone names a person (preferably an actor, but with some creativity you can name anyone) and they try to reach "Kevin Bacon" within six people. Here's another example using an actor:

 

1. Jason Biggs (Jim from American Pie) was in that movie with....

2. Eugene Levy, who was in Club Paradise with ....

3. Robin Williams, who was in Awakenings with....

4. Robert Deniro, who was in Sleepers with....

5. KEVIN BACON!

 

Go to The Oracle of Bacon at Virginia and try another name.
